Abstract :
The underwater synchronous scanner imaging model (USSIM) was developed as a software tool for exploring the design-trade space of the laser line scan system (LLSS). The critical software modules of USSIM have been subjected to a stressful validation process that relied on laboratory data collected with the LLSS. This validation effort demonstrated the utility of USSIM´s predictive capabilities. The paper provides a description of the model and presents the results of the validation work
